The Island's Safeguarding Board has appointed Lesley Walker as its new Independent Chair.
Ms Walker, a qualified social worker with 35 years safeguarding experience, will take up the post in April 2021.
She brings extensive experience of chairing Safeguarding Boards, Partnerships and panels in England and Northern Ireland.
Ms Walker said she's 'delighted' to have been offered the position.
